Step-by-Step: How to Actually Claim (Without Getting Ripped Off)
Okay, let’s do this properly. You want to make a claim? Fine. Here is the only way to do it without getting burned.

- Check the T&Cs before you even click ‘Register’. Find the exact wagering requirement. Is it 35x? 40x? That number matters more than the bonus amount. A 100% match with 35x wagering is better than a 200% match with 45x wagering. Do the math.
- Make sure PayPal is listed as a deposit method on the offer. Sometimes the offer is for Visa only. Don’t assume. Look for the tiny asterisk that says “excluding PayPal”.
- Deposit the minimum to qualify. Usually £10 or £20. Do not go all in on the first deposit. Test the site first. See if the games even load properly on your phone.
- Claim the bonus immediately. Most offers expire within 72 hours. If you wait three days, the bonus is gone. This happened to me with a Mr Green offer. I forgot. Wasted opportunity.
- Start with low volatility slots. You want to meet the wagering requirement, not win a jackpot. Low volatility games give you smaller, more frequent wins that extend your playtime. High volatility games can drain your bonus balance in five minutes.

FAQs: The Ugly Truth About These Offers
Can I withdraw my bonus immediately?
No. That’s not how it works. The bonus is locked in a “bonus balance.” You have to wager it first. For example, if you get a £20 bonus with 35x wagering, you need to bet £700 worth of spins before you can touch that £20. It’s designed to be hard. So, no, you cannot just take the money and run.
Do all UK casinos accept PayPal for the welcome offer?
Not all of them. Some smaller brands exclude e-wallets like PayPal or Skrill from the main welcome offer. You have to read the specific “Eligible Payment Methods” section. Betway usually includes it. Some others? Not so much. Always double-check. It’s annoying, but it’s the only way to avoid disappointment.
What happens if I self-exclude after claiming the bonus?
You lose the bonus. The wagering stops. You can withdraw any remaining real cash, but the bonus cash disappears. This is standard. The casino is legally required to respect your self-exclusion request immediately. So, if you use that tool, the bonus is gone. That’s the trade-off for safety.
Are the wagering requirements the same for slots and table games?
Absolutely not. Slots usually count 100% towards wagering. Blackjack? That counts 10% or even 0%. Some offers straight up exclude table games. This is a classic trap. If you are a blackjack player, a slots bonus is useless to you. Look for “wagering on all games” offers, but those are rare. Stick to slots for the bonus.
